Normal and Fighting

If a Pokémon with Mummy is targeted by a Normal- or Fighting-type move, does Mummy's effect activate? —darklordtrom 00:40, 5 November 2010 (UTC)

Yes, if the Pokémon with mummy isn't Ghost.----無限の知性DENNOUZENSHI 14:32, 5 November 2010 (UTC)
To clarify: in the case of the only two mons that have it, no. But only because it is a Ghost type, and Normal/Fighting moves with Contact will not [i]actually[/i] make contact, thus not triggering the ability at all. If a non-Ghost mon could legitimately posess Mummy, then yes, it would behave normally even with Normal/Fighting contact moves, as long as there is no other impedence on its contact.
